PAACADEMY offers professional online sustainability courses for architects, teaching data-driven environmental analysis, climate-adaptive design and energy simulation using Grasshopper plugins like Ladybug and Honeybee. PAACADEMY's Sustainability courses are designed to equip architects and designers with the computational tools needed to create environmentally responsible and climate-adaptive architecture. Rather than relying on intuition, these courses teach participants how to use parametric workflows to analyze, simulate and optimize building performance at every stage of the design process. Our curriculum focuses on integrating environmental data directly into Grasshopper-based workflows, covering: Climate Analysis: Utilizing Ladybug to visualize weather data, sun paths, wind roses and solar radiation, allowing designers to respond directly to local microclimates. Daylight & Energy Simulation: Using Honeybee and ClimateStudio to run advanced daylighting analysis, thermal comfort evaluations and energy modeling. Performance-Driven Form Finding: Linking environmental simulation data back to parametric models to automatically optimize building massing, facade shading and orientation for maximum sustainability. By mastering these computational sustainability tools, architects can move beyond greenwashing and validate their design decisions with precise environmental data, ensuring their buildings perform efficiently in the real world.
